Crisis Simulation & Human Performance Lead
Directs immersive emergency simulations to optimize cognitive performance and decision-making under extreme stress.
Overview
The daily work involves a rigorous blend of data analysis and physical operational management within simulated environments. Leads spend significant time reviewing physiological data such as heart rate variability and cognitive load metrics to assess how individuals react to escalating crises. This role requires a meticulous approach to scenario planning, ensuring that every variable from environmental audio to sensory distractions serves a specific psychological objective.
Thriving in this field requires a clinical objectivity and the ability to maintain composure while overseeing high-tension scenarios. The rhythm of the work alternates between periods of quiet research and intense, multi-day simulation exercises where the Lead must coordinate dozens of actors and technicians. Professionals solve problems related to human error, team communication breakdowns, and the limits of cognitive endurance in life-threatening situations.

Responsibilities
- Design complex simulation scripts that challenge specific psychological and operational performance markers.
- Coordinate with medical and technical teams to integrate bio-monitoring hardware into training exercises.
- Analyze biometric and behavioral data to identify patterns of cognitive failure or success.
- Brief senior leadership on the psychological readiness and operational limitations of response units.
- Manage the physical logistics of simulation sites including safety protocols and equipment maintenance.
- Develop evidence-based training modules focused on stress inoculation and rapid decision-making.
- Collaborate with software engineers to refine virtual or augmented reality crisis scenarios.

Frequently asked questions
What does a Crisis Simulation & Human Performance Lead do?
A Crisis Simulation & Human Performance Lead designs and manages high-fidelity stress-response simulations for emergency response teams. They apply neuroscience principles to analyze and optimize human performance in high-stakes environments, ensuring teams can function effectively under extreme pressure.
What skills are needed for a Crisis Simulation & Human Performance Lead?
Successful leads require a deep understanding of neuroscience, behavioral psychology, and stress-response mechanisms. Technical expertise in simulation design, data analysis, and emergency management protocols is essential for creating realistic training scenarios and measuring performance outcomes.
What is the career path for a Crisis Simulation & Human Performance Lead?
The career path typically begins with a background in neuroscience, human factors engineering, or emergency services management. Professionals often progress from simulation specialists or performance analysts into leadership roles, eventually overseeing complex training programs for government agencies or private security firms.
